Posted by Mark Gulbrandsen (Member # 72) on 11-03-2008, 07:24 AM:
 
quote: Mike Blakesley
Stuff shifts in shipping - this is not exactly a rocket science adjustment.

Nadda! It for sure does not shift in shipping but the placement of the DTS track is what is not consistant. I had a long discission about this with Clyde McKinney during lunch at the last Dolby training class. He's looked into making DTS "buzz track" but says there is no refrence for the placement of the track in relation to the inside edge of a perf, which is how placement of all other parts of a film frame are spec'd. DTS instead spec'd it from the edge of the film... and since film witdh does vary so does the placement of the track. Now the DTS TCR's have a very wide scanning area that they can read but on occasion a track may be on the very edge of that scanning area.... Thats when adjusting the scanner may bring it back to working state. However... in reality you have a defective print who's track is too far out of range and you should request a new one.

Marco is also correct in that you should check the gain of your LED... before ever turning that lateral adjustment screw! It should be 4vdc between the two test points in the reader without film threaded through it. It could be a bit too low... say around 2 volts... which is too low for consistant reading where differing densities of tracks may affect it.

Posted by Marco Giustini (Member # 4544) on 11-03-2008, 07:03 PM:
 
I had a DTS reader few years ago. It never read correctly. One print was fine, the other's not. The led was flashing too much.
With the help of DTS I tried to align the screw, it's simple: you turn it to the points where the reader does not read anymore, then set it in the middle. But I had to set it different for each movie.
I tried everything: ground connections, tension from platter...

Then I was able to borrow an old reader from another theater. And despite it was a rev F, and mine was a rev H, that old, rusted (Really!) reader was reading EVERYTHING.

So I asked for a replacement of my reader. From that moment (2+ years ago) NEVER had a single issue with Timecode. I just check the LED gain every few months.

This is why I do not recommend you to adjust the screw, or at least to try something else first.

Posted by John Hawkinson (Member # 1135) on 11-04-2008, 12:53 PM:
 
There's no dispute that adjusting the screw can help in many cases. The problems are:

(1) It can screw you for all future prints that are not misprinted, and you do not have a good way to adjust it back to the location where it belongs.

(2) Just because changing the position fixes your problem doesn't mean it is the right fix. Many problems could result in the reader scanning a narrower width than it should (low gain, photocell problems, dirty optics). Moving the position of that narrower scanning for a given print can solve your immediate problem, but the root problem. And then when you turn up the gain pot (easy), you're screwed to recalibrate.
